#!/usr/bin/env python3
import os, base64, hashlib, shutil, mimetypes
from functools import reduce
SYNC_DIR = "SYNC_DIR"
SYNC_TYPE = "SYNC_TYPE"
SYNC_BUCKET = "SYNC_BUCKET"
SYNC_REGION = "SYNC_REGION"
SYNC_ACCESS_ID = "SYNC_ACCESS_ID"
SYNC_ACCESS_SECRET = "SYNC_ACCESS_SECRET"
SYNC_OPT_UNUSED = "SYNC_OPT_UNUSED"
mimetypes.add_type("text/javascript", ".js")
mimetypes.add_type("font/woff", ".woff")
mimetypes.add_type("font/woff2", ".woff2")
def guess_mime(fpath):
"""
Guess mime by any path.
>>> guess_mime('path/to/index.html')
'text/html'
>>> guess_mime('path/to/index.xhtml')
'application/xhtml+xml'
>>> guess_mime('path/to/index.txt')
'text/plain'
>>> guess_mime('path/to/INDEX.JPEG')
'image/jpeg'
>>> guess_mime('path/to/INDEX.WEBP')
'image/webp'
>>> guess_mime('path/to/index.otf')
'font/otf'
>>> guess_mime('path/to/index.woff')
'font/woff'
>>> guess_mime('path/to/index.woff2')
'font/woff2'
>>> guess_mime('path/to/index.css')
'text/css'
>>> guess_mime('path/to/index.js')
'text/javascript'
>>> guess_mime('path/to/index.mp4')
'video/mp4'
>>> guess_mime('path/to/download.zip')
'application/zip'
>>> guess_mime('path/to/favicon.ico')
'image/x-icon'
>>> guess_mime('path/to/index.tgzzz')
'application/octet-stream'
>>> guess_mime('path/to/index')
'application/octet-stream'
"""
_, ext = os.path.splitext(fpath)
return mimetypes.types_map.get(ext.lower(), "application/octet-stream")
def sorted_objs(objs):
return sorted(objs, key=lambda d: d["key"])
def file_objs_to_dict(acc, obj):
'file object list to dict using obj["key"] as key.'
key = obj["key"]
if not key.endswith("/"):
acc[key] = obj
return acc
def diff(src_objs, dest_objs):
"""
Create a diff by return adds, updates, deletes object list.
>>> objs = walkdir('_site')
>>> src_objs = objs[:] + [dict(key='z/update.txt', size=200, md5='UUUUUUUUUUUUUUUUUUUUUU==')]
>>> dest_objs = objs[1:] + [dict(key='z/update.txt', size=100, md5='GOVl8c0J5IQiUlDtTe4LFM=='), dict(key='z/delete.txt', size=123, md5='ZZZZZZZZZZZZZZZZZZZZZZ==')]
>>> a, u, d = diff(src_objs, dest_objs)
>>> a
[{'key': 'README.md', 'size': 47, 'md5': 'SPgiydU0kcyQmcQv/4ZIyA=='}]
>>> u
[{'key': 'z/update.txt', 'size': 200, 'md5': 'UUUUUUUUUUUUUUUUUUUUUU=='}]
>>> d
[{'key': 'z/delete.txt', 'size': 123, 'md5': 'ZZZZZZZZZZZZZZZZZZZZZZ=='}]
"""
adds = []
updates = []
deletes = []
local_objs = src_objs[:]
remote_objs = reduce(file_objs_to_dict, dest_objs, {})
for obj in local_objs:
key = obj["key"]
if key in remote_objs:
# remote has obj with same key:
robj = remote_objs[key]
if obj["size"] != robj["size"] or obj["md5"] != robj["md5"]:
# need update:
updates.append(obj)
del remote_objs[key]
else:
# key not found in remote:
adds.append(obj)
deletes = list(remote_objs.values())
return sorted_objs(adds), sorted_objs(updates), sorted_objs(deletes)
def file_b64md5(fpath):
"""
File md5 using base64.
>>> file_b64md5('LICENSE')
'HrvT40I3rybaXcCKTkQEZA=='
"""
md5 = hashlib.md5()
with open(fpath, "rb") as fp:
md5.update(fp.read())
return base64.b64encode(md5.digest()).decode("utf-8")
def etag_to_md5(s):
"""
Convert E-Tag to b64-md5.
>>> etag_to_md5("1ebbd3e34237af26da5dc08a4e440464")
'HrvT40I3rybaXcCKTkQEZA=='
>>> etag_to_md5('"1ebbd3e34237af26da5dc08a4e440464"')
'HrvT40I3rybaXcCKTkQEZA=='
>>> etag_to_md5('"1EBBD3E34237AF26DA5DC08A4E440464"')
'HrvT40I3rybaXcCKTkQEZA=='
"""
etag = s
if etag.startswith('"'):
etag = etag[1:]
if etag.endswith('"'):
etag = etag[:-1]
if len(etag) == 32:
etag = etag.lower()
return base64.b64encode(bytes.fromhex(etag)).decode("utf-8")
# for etag not using MD5, return '000...000':
return "AAAAAAAAAAAAAAAAAAAAAA=="
def walkdir(p):
"""
List files recursively in a directory. Each object is a dict with:
{
"key": "path/to/file", # s3 compatible path without prefix "/"
"size": 12345, # file size
"md5": "HrvT40I3rybaXcCKTkQEZA==" # base64-encoded md5
}
>>> fs = walkdir('_site')
>>> fs[0]
{'key': 'README.md', 'size': 47, 'md5': 'SPgiydU0kcyQmcQv/4ZIyA=='}
>>> fs[-1]
{'key': 'z/last.txt', 'size': 22, 'md5': '9PR5WPGJrCSbsqksh2SBlQ=='}
"""
prefix = len(p)
if not p.endswith("/"):
prefix = prefix + 1
objs = []
for root, _, files in os.walk(p):
for f in files:
fp = os.path.join(root, f)
objs.append({"key": fp[prefix:], "size": os.path.getsize(fp), "md5": file_b64md5(fp)})
return sorted_objs(objs)
def rmdir(p):
if os.path.isdir(p):
shutil.rmtree(p)
def mkdirs(p):
if not os.path.isdir(p):
os.makedirs(p)
if __name__ == "__main__":
import doctest
doctest.testmod()
